About Muscat

City overview

Muscat stretches along the Gulf of Oman between rocky hills, old harbors, royal forts, beach districts, and low-rise modern suburbs. First-time visits work by grouping Old Muscat, Mutrah, Qurum, Al Ghubrah, and Al Bustan rather than trying to walk a single center.

Food & drink

Muscat food includes shuwa, majboos, harees, mishkak skewers, grilled hammour, Omani halwa, dates, karak tea, and strong South Asian restaurant influence. Mutrah, Ruwi, Qurum, Turkish grills, and seaside fish restaurants give the easiest first route.

  • Mutrah Corniche in Muscat1

    Mutrah Corniche

    4.6outdoorOpen daily

    The harborfront promenade curves past cruise berths, old merchant houses, Mutrah Fort, and the fish market. It is best at sunrise or after sunset in hot months.

  • Al Alam Palace in Muscat2

    Al Alam Palace

    4.6outdoorOpen daily

    The ceremonial palace sits in Old Muscat between Al Jalali and Al Mirani forts. Visitors see it from the gates and plaza rather than inside.

  • Mutrah Souq in Muscat3

    Mutrah Souq

    4.4outdoorOpen daily

    The covered market sells frankincense, khanjars, textiles, silver, perfumes, spices, and tourist goods in a maze just off the Corniche.

Neighborhoods

  • Old Muscat in muscat om1

    Old Muscat

    Old Muscat is ceremonial and quiet, with Al Alam Palace, forts, museums, government buildings, and cliffs around the harbor.

  • Muţraḩ in muscat om2

    Mutrah

    Mutrah is the historic trade quarter, with the Corniche, souq, fish market, fort, cruise port, and frankincense-heavy lanes.

  • Ruwi in muscat om3

    Ruwi

    Ruwi is busy and practical, with South Asian restaurants, shops, banks, budget hotels, and bus connections.

  • Qurum and Shati Al Qurum in muscat om4

    Qurum and Shati Al Qurum

    Qurum is beach-facing and residential, with the opera house, cafes, parks, malls, embassies, and seaside walks.

  • Al Ghubrah and Bawshar in muscat om5

    Al Ghubrah and Bawshar

    The central suburbs hold the Grand Mosque, malls, hotels, schools, and long arterial roads through modern Muscat.

  • Al Bustan Public Beach in Muscat6

    Al Bustan, Qantab, and Bandar Jissah

    The eastern coves feel resort-like and rocky, with palace roads, small beaches, diving boats, and mountain backdrops.

Day trips

  • 150km / 1.5-2h by car from Muscat

    Wadi Shab and Bimmah Sinkhole

    The coastal highway leads to turquoise pools, canyon walks, and the limestone sinkhole. Start early and bring water shoes.

  • 160km / about 2h by car from Muscat

    Nizwa

    Nizwa Fort, the souq, date market, and nearby mountain villages make the strongest inland heritage day.

  • 70km / 45min by boat from Al Mouj or Seeb after driving from Muscat

    Dimaniyat Islands

    The marine reserve is known for snorkeling, turtles, and clear water, with access controlled by boat operators and permits.

Getting around

Muscat is spread out and hot, so taxis, ride-hail, rental cars, and Mwasalat buses matter more than walking. Group Old Muscat with Mutrah, and handle Qurum, the Grand Mosque, and airport-side stops as separate car-based moves.

What to pack for Muscat in November

Pack for November's weather, not a generic Muscat checklist.

  • Light, breathable daytime clothes for average highs around 30°C / 86°F.
  • A light evening layer because nights average 21°C / 69°F.
  • Sun protection and comfortable walking shoes; rain is usually limited this month.
How many days do you need in Muscat
4 days covers the main Muscat highlights at a realistic pace. Add 3 extra days if you want the listed day trips.
